The Challenge

The primary challenge for Global Talent Solutions stemmed directly from the sheer volume and unstructured nature of incoming resumes. On any given day, GTS received hundreds of applications across various global roles. Each resume, often submitted in differing formats (PDF, Word doc, etc.), required meticulous manual review to extract key information, standardize it, and accurately input it into their Keap CRM system. This process was not only labor-intensive but also fraught with potential for human error.

Consider the impact: an average of 15-20 minutes was spent per resume by a highly-paid recruitment coordinator or associate. This included opening the document, scanning for critical keywords, copying and pasting data points into predefined CRM fields, categorizing skills, and ensuring contact information was correct. Multiply this by hundreds of resumes daily, and the cumulative time sink became astronomical. This translated into hundreds of hours each month diverted from strategic tasks like candidate engagement, client relationship management, and market analysis.

Beyond the time cost, GTS experienced several critical pain points:

  • **Slow Candidate Processing:** The manual bottleneck led to delays in candidate response times, risking the loss of top talent to competitors who could move faster.
  • **Data Inconsistency & Errors:** Manual data entry inevitably introduced inconsistencies and errors into the CRM, leading to skewed analytics, inefficient searches, and potential compliance issues.
  • **Resource Misallocation:** High-value HR and recruitment professionals were trapped in low-value administrative work, preventing them from focusing on strategic initiatives where their expertise could truly drive impact.
  • **Scalability Constraints:** As GTS aimed for further expansion, their existing process was inherently unscalable, placing a hard limit on the number of applications they could effectively manage without a proportional increase in headcount.
  • **Lack of a Single Source of Truth:** Data was often fragmented or duplicated across various temporary documents before finally being entered into the CRM, making it difficult to maintain a consistent and accurate “single source of truth” for candidate profiles.

Our Solution

4Spot Consulting approached Global Talent Solutions’ complex challenge with our proprietary OpsMap™ framework, beginning with a deep strategic audit. We meticulously analyzed their existing resume intake process, identifying every manual touchpoint, data silo, and opportunity for error. Our goal was not just to automate a task, but to re-engineer an entire workflow for maximum efficiency and strategic advantage.

The core of our solution leveraged a powerful combination of low-code automation with Make.com (formerly Integromat) and advanced AI capabilities for data extraction and enrichment. Our OpsBuild™ phase focused on constructing an intelligent automation pipeline designed to:

  1. **Automated Resume Intake:** Establish a seamless integration with GTS’s various application sources (website forms, email attachments, LinkedIn submissions) to automatically pull new resumes into the workflow.
  2. **AI-Powered Parsing and Data Extraction:** Implement AI models specifically trained to parse diverse resume formats. This AI was configured to accurately extract crucial information such as contact details, work history, education, skills, certifications, and even project-specific keywords, far beyond standard OCR capabilities.
  3. **Data Standardization and Enrichment:** Automatically clean, standardize, and enrich extracted data. For instance, normalizing job titles, standardizing date formats, and cross-referencing skill sets against a predefined taxonomy to ensure consistency.
  4. **Direct CRM Integration (Keap):** Seamlessly integrate the parsed and enriched data directly into GTS’s Keap CRM system. This ensured that every new candidate profile was created instantly and accurately, populating all relevant fields without human intervention. The system was designed to update existing records or create new ones, preventing duplicates and maintaining a true single source of truth.
  5. **Automated Notifications and Workflow Triggers:** Configure the system to trigger subsequent actions, such as sending automated acknowledgment emails to candidates, notifying specific recruiters about new relevant profiles, or initiating preliminary screening questionnaires based on extracted criteria.
  6. **Robust Error Handling & Reporting:** Implement mechanisms for flagging and reporting any data parsing anomalies that required human review, ensuring no critical information was lost and providing transparency into the automation’s performance.

Implementation Steps

The implementation of Global Talent Solutions’ AI-powered resume automation was executed through a structured, iterative process guided by 4Spot Consulting’s OpsBuild™ framework. This ensured minimal disruption, robust testing, and maximum buy-in from the GTS team:

  1. **Discovery & Blueprinting (OpsMap™ Deep Dive):**
    • Initial workshops with GTS HR, IT, and recruitment stakeholders to map the complete current state of resume processing.
    • Detailed documentation of all data points required for the Keap CRM, specific parsing rules, and existing tools.
    • Identification of integration points and security protocols for their various application sources and CRM.
    • Creation of a comprehensive solution blueprint, outlining the technical architecture, AI models to be used, and the complete end-to-end automated workflow.
  2. **Platform & Tool Selection/Configuration:**
    • Leveraged Make.com as the central orchestration platform for its flexibility and extensive integration capabilities.
    • Selected and configured specialized AI parsing APIs capable of handling diverse resume structures and extracting specific entities.
    • Set up secure API connections between Make.com, GTS’s various application portals, and their Keap CRM.
  3. **Workflow Development & AI Training (OpsBuild™ Core):**
    • Developed the core automation scenarios in Make.com, orchestrating the flow from intake to parsing, enrichment, and CRM entry.
    • Trained the AI models using a diverse set of anonymized GTS resumes to ensure high accuracy in extracting relevant fields specific to their industry needs.
    • Implemented data standardization rules and enrichment logic within the Make.com scenarios.
    • Built in error handling and notification mechanisms to alert GTS personnel of any processing exceptions.
  4. **Phased Testing & Iteration:**
    • **Unit Testing:** Individual components (e.g., API connections, AI parsing module, CRM data pushes) were tested in isolation.
    • **Integrated System Testing:** Performed end-to-end testing with sample resumes, verifying data flow, accuracy, and CRM updates.
    • **User Acceptance Testing (UAT):** GTS power users were engaged to test the system with real-world scenarios, providing feedback for refinements and optimizations.
    • Iterated on AI model training and workflow adjustments based on UAT feedback to achieve desired accuracy and performance.
  5. **Deployment & Training:**
    • Gradual rollout of the automated system, initially running in parallel with the manual process to ensure a smooth transition.
    • Comprehensive training sessions for GTS recruitment coordinators and HR staff on monitoring the automation, handling exceptions, and leveraging the newly enriched CRM data.
    • Developed detailed documentation and SOPs for ongoing system management.
  6. **Post-Launch Monitoring & Optimization (OpsCare™):**
    • Continuous monitoring of system performance, data accuracy, and integration health.
    • Regular reviews with GTS to identify further optimization opportunities and adapt the automation to evolving business needs.
    • Provided ongoing support and maintenance to ensure the system operated at peak efficiency.

The Results

The implementation of 4Spot Consulting’s AI-powered resume automation had a transformative impact on Global Talent Solutions’ operations, delivering quantifiable improvements across several key metrics:

  • **150+ Hours Saved Per Month:**

    The most immediate and impactful result was the drastic reduction in manual labor. GTS’s recruitment team saved an average of 150-180 hours per month that was previously dedicated to resume parsing and data entry. This translates to an estimated **$7,500 – $9,000 in monthly operational cost savings** (based on an average burdened hourly rate of $50 for administrative staff), or **over $90,000 annually** in reclaimed human capital.

  • **85% Reduction in Resume Processing Time:**

    Before automation, a single resume took approximately 15-20 minutes to manually process and enter into the CRM. With the new system, resumes are parsed, enriched, and pushed to Keap CRM in an average of **2-3 minutes**, representing an 85% efficiency gain. This dramatically accelerated their candidate pipeline.

  • **98% Data Accuracy Rate:**

    The AI-driven parsing and data standardization virtually eliminated human error. GTS reported a **98% accuracy rate** for extracted data, a significant improvement over the previous manual process which often saw inconsistencies due to fatigue or varied interpretation.

  • **24/7 Processing Capability:**

    The automation operates around the clock, allowing GTS to process applications instantly as they arrive, regardless of business hours or geographical location. This led to faster response times to candidates and a more responsive recruitment process overall.
